International Journal of Society, Culture and Language is a peer-reviewed journal that publishes research within the area of anthropology. The journal's founding editor-in-Chief is Reza Pishghadam Ferdowsi University of Mashhad. The journal was established in 2013. The journal is a venue for studies that demonstrate sound research methods and report findings that have clear pedagogical and cultural implications. A wide range of topics in the area of anthropology is covered, including: Linguistics, Sociology of language, and Cross-cultural studies.
